Double hung window repl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ows and installing new units that feature two movable sashes, allowing for easy opening and closing from either the top or bottom. This type of window design is popular for its versatility and classic appearance, making it suitable for a variety of property styles. When replacing these windows, professionals ensure a proper fit and seal to impro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and enhance the overall comfort of a home or commercial space. The process typically includes careful measurement, removal of the existing window, and precise installation of the new window to ensure smooth operation and long-lasting performance.
This service helps address common problems such as difficulty opening or closing windows, drafts that lead to higher energy bills, and issues with window insulation. Over time, windows can become warped, cracked, or decayed, which can compromise security and increase maintenance needs. Double hung window replacement can also improve the aesthetic appeal of a property by updating the look with modern, energy-efficient models. For homeowners experiencing frequent drafts, condensation between panes, or difficulty operating their current windows, professional replacement offers a practical solution that can enhance comfort and reduce ongoing repair costs.

The overview below groups typical Double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Roanoke,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ine double hung window repairs in Roanoke, TX typ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ve replacing sashes or hardware and are usually on the lower end of the cost spectrum.
Partial Replacement - Replacing several windows or a single larger window can range from $600 to $1,500, depending on the size and materials. Most projects in this range are common for homeowners updating multiple units.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of a standard double hung window generally falls between $1,500 and $3,500.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or custom jobs can cost more.
Larger or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ate window replacements or multi-window installations can re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ent but typically involve custom features or structural work that increases cost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
